Landscape developers are designers that produce landscape styles which can consist of growing plans, hardscaping, and other yard functions. They are likewise varied in their history and skillsets. Several have degrees in art, design, cultivation, or landscape style. They should recognize fundamental design principles, be creative, and have substantial plant knowledge.


3 Easy Facts About Landscapers Explained




Some landscape designers will certainly work for themselves, as component of a small team, or with a larger landscape design company. This kind of company will have a group with various types of landscape professionals.


They can offer the landscape as one plan; the style, installment, and treatment. A landscape professional will certainly install a style that has been developed by a landscape designer or developer.


A landscaping company is a professional who provides yard care services and most likely some installation services as well such as growing. They normally offer routine services like spring and drop clean-up, weeding, bordering, mulching, trimming, condition and bug therapy (if they are qualified). They might have additional services like lawn care.


Anybody can buy a couple of devices and call themselves a landscaping company. This is why it is essential to judge the requirements of your landscape, research study the business, and employ the correct professional.
